de.avetana.bluetooth.util
Class EVector

java.lang.Object
  extended byde.avetana.bluetooth.util.EVector

public class EVector
extends java.lang.Object

COPYRIGHT:
(c) Copyright 2004 Avetana GmbH ALL RIGHTS RESERVED.

This file is part of the Avetana bluetooth API for Linux.

The Avetana bluetooth API for Linux is free software; you can redistribute it and/or modify it under the terms of the GNU General Public License as published by the Free Software Foundation; either version 2 of the License, or (at your option) any later version.

The Avetana bluetooth API is distributed in the hope that it will be useful, but WITHOUT 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U General Public License for more details.

The development of the Avetana bluetooth API is based on the work of Christian Lorenz (see the Javabluetooth Stack at http://www.javabluetooth.org) for some classes, on the work of the jbluez team (see http://jbluez.sourceforge.net/) and on the work of the bluez team (see the BlueZ linux Stack at http://www.bluez.org) for the C code. Classes, part of classes, C functions or part of C functions programmed by these teams and/or persons are explicitly mentioned.



Description:
A Vector of PElement.


Constructor Summary
EVector()
           
 
Method Summary
 void add(PElement el)
           
 java.lang.Object clone()
           
 boolean contains(PElement el)
           
 PElement elementAt(int i)
           
 void remove(PElement p)
           
 int size()
           
 
Methods inherited from class java.lang.Object
equ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

EVector

public EVector()
Method Detail

clone

public java.lang.Object clone()

contains

public boolean contains(PElement el)

add

public void add(PElement el)

elementAt

public PElement elementAt(int i)

remove

public void remove(PElement p)

size

public int size()